Responsibilities

  • Coordinate responses to Requests for Information (RFIs), Requests for Proposal (RFPs), and Requests for Quotation (RFQs) with internal and external customers.
  • Review Statements of Work (SOWs) with the program team and prepare Estimate Requests (ERs) for estimating and pricing to develop proposals.
  • Coordinate proposal preparation, manage and prepare internal documentation for gate reviews and document management approvals for submission to the customer.
  • Develop proposal strategy to mitigate risk and review terms and conditions of contract documents for compliance with internal policies and procedures.
  • Develop negotiation strategy and lead negotiations with commercial and/or international government customers ensuring customer needs are satisfied while meeting Bell’s business and financial objectives.
  • Performs contract administration from contract award to contract closeout, which may include: internal notification of contract award and coordination of requirements to functional departments to advise of obligations during performance, contract notifications to customer, identification and resolution of changes by application of knowledge of contract clauses and policies and procedures, monitor funding and expenditures, documentation of delivery/completion to the customer, and contract closeout.
  • Assess, maintain, and utilize Bell information management systems for reports, metrics, correspondence, files, presentations, analyses, and contract administration.
  • Manage special assignments and projects for Bell’s commercial business strategy and adapt and improve business processes to meet company goals and satisfy customer needs.
  • Coordinate with and influence personnel in multiple functions, Integrated Program Teams (IPTs), and Centers of Excellence (COEs) and at a variety of levels to ensure effective and efficient compliance with contractual and customer requirements.
  • Demonstrate exceptional customer relationship management skills and be primary liaison between external customer and Bell for all contractual matters.
